I used stamping, layered stenciling, heat embossing, masking, sponging and die cuts

I started by masking and sponging some Distress Ink on a card front.

Then I laid the star stencil on top and used some metallic gold creme through it.

When it was completely dry, I laid the Falling Snow stencil over the top and
added embossing paste.  While the paste was still wet, I sprinkled
Dazzling Diamond glitter over the top and shook off the excess.

My mask slipped and I had a pretty bad smudge on the top, so it sat there for a few days.

I decided to cut the sponging out and placed it on some gold foil for a border.

I realized I didn't have any stamping, so I had to do some head scratching to
 figure out how to finish this card and fit the challenge.

You can see how I solved that problem.

You can also see some, but not all, of the shine.

Oh, and I die cut the JOY 3 times so it would stand out.

Card Recipe
Stamps: Holly Jolly Greetings (SU)
Ink:  Blueprint Sketch (DI), Encore Gold
Paper:  Neena, Gold Foil (SU)
Other:  Stars Shimmer Stencil (MB), Metallic Gold Modellier Creme (Viva), Falling Snow Stencil (SSS), Embossing Paste (WV), Greetings Die (PB), Dazzling Diamonds (SU)
